Next Xbox game is Gears of War, it's free for Xbox if you already have GoW:U.

Quote:
Gears of War: Reloaded launches August 26, 2025, for $39.99 SRP on Xbox Series X|S, Xbox PC, Xbox Cloud Gaming, PlayStation 5 and Steam, and arrives day one with Game Pass Ultimate or PC Game Pass.
Quote:
No matter where you play, Gears of War: Reloaded has been re-engineered to look and feel incredible. Players can expect:
  • 4K resolution
  • 60 FPS in Campaign
  • 120 FPS in Multiplayer
  • High Dynamic Range (HDR)
  • Dolby Vision & 7.1.4 Dolby Atmos
  • 7.1.4 3D Spatial Audio
  • Variable Refresh Rate (VRR)
  • 4K assets and remastered textures
  • Enhanced post-processing visual effects
  • Improved shadows and reflections
  • Super resolution with improved anti-aliasing
  • Zero loading screens during Campaign

Didn't know PS5 had Dolby Vision support, or will GoW be the first game to support it on PS5?

No MS account required, I think this is a first for multi-platform Xbox online games.
Quote:
Gears of War: Reloaded is built for shared play — whether you’re teaming up in split-screen or jumping online. The Campaign supports two-player co-op, and Versus Multiplayer allows up to 8 players. With cross-play across all platforms, you and your friends can squad up no matter where you play — no Microsoft account required.
I assume the below quote means there will be Dual Sense support, along with PSSR for the PS5 Pro Enhanced version.
Quote:
And wherever you play, we’re meeting you there with the best version possible. Gears of War: Reloaded includes platform-specific features that make the most of the hardware you already own to deliver a world-class Gears of War experience — faithful to the original, optimized for today, and made for everyone.
